    Kurdish lawmaker: Re-assigning Abdul-Mahdi will have our support

    10:49 - 02/03/2020

    Information / Baghdad ..
    MP from the Kurdistan Islamic Union, Bakr Amin, confirmed on Monday that the reassignment of resigned Prime Minister [You must be registered and logged in to see this link.] will have the approval and support of most of the Kurdish blocs, while he warned that his reassignment may generate a new crisis.
    Bakr said in a statement to "Information", that "the constitution obliges the President of the Republic to assign another person in the event of the failure of the first official to form a government." one more time".
    He added that "the reassignment of [You must be registered and logged in to see this link.] for a transitional period until early elections will gain Kurdish acceptance and some other political forces," stressing that "the re-election of Abdul Mahdi will not be easy, but will face a greater political crisis than what confronted the commissioner, Mohammed Tawfiq Allawi."
    The Prime Minister-designate Muhammad Tawfiq Allawi announced in an hour, today, Monday, his apology for continuing to form a government a month after his appointment. Ended in / 25 pm
